The Apatsahayeswara Temple at Alangudi is regarded as the Guru Sthalam or Jupiter centre where Lord Dakshinamurthy is worshipped. The Shrine attracts a large number of devotees when Jupiter transits between zodiac signs every year.
Guruvayur Krishna Temple is another sacred pilgrimage centre which is also a Guru Sthalam since Guru & Vayu are presiding deities protecting this place. Murugan devotees instantly will be drawn to the Gurusthalam amongst the Aarupadaiveedu, the famous Tiruchendur temple.Madhwa devotees can offer pooja at Sri Raghavendra Swamy Matha.
